The 3 most important things you need to know:

  1. The Office of Military & Veteran Success (OMVS) processes all military benefits at Southeastern Louisiana University. Please direct all questions regarding your military funding and benefits to our office by visiting, calling, or emailing us at veterans@southeastern.edu . We look forward to meeting you!
  2. You must turn in a copy of your Certificate of Eligibility from the VA. If we do not have this form, we can not submit your enrollment hours or bill the VA for your courses.
  3. You must submit the Veterans Certification Request form to our office in the Student Union Annex every semester that you are enrolled in order for any of your military benefits to be applied to your account, regardless of which benefit you are using.

In the Office of Military and Veteran Success (OMVS), we don't just process military benefits. We also offer the following:

  • Priority class registration for all student veterans and any dependent student who is registered with the OMVS and using benefits
  • Priority housing registration for all student veterans and any dependent student who is registered with the OMVS and using benefits (NEW! for Fall 2024)
  • Waived admissions application fee (must upload DD214 to admissions application)
  • Job placement assistance through NextOpVets and FourBlock
  • Annual Military Appreciation Football Game in November
  • Military Graduation Luncheon to honor graduating students each semester
  • Free entry into all Southeastern home baseball games on Sundays with Military ID
  • Free school supplies for students, courtesy of Combat Vets Motorcycle Association (CVMA) Chapter 6-8 
  • Part-time VA Work Study positions in the OMVS
  • Army ROTC program available to all students
  • Assistance with applying for third-party scholarships through Folds of Honor, Veterans of Foreign Wars, American Legion, and AMVets
  • Computer lab and lounge for studying
  • CAC readers available at all office computers
  • Small library of personal development books available for check-out
  • Coffee, soda, and snacks available year-round
  • Special Veterans designation for Career Fair to signify veteran status with employers
  • Discounted community membership for veterans at the University Recreation Center 
  • Veterans healthcare benefits counseling through LAVetCorps and LDVA partnership
  • Army-style obstacle course with 10 obstacles. Located on the Rugby field on North Campus.
